Abstract
A relatively flat sheet metal structural web member for interconnecting a pair of generally parallel spaced-apart chord members to form a floor truss or the like. The web member is generally V-shaped, comprising first and second legs integrally joined at one of their respective ends, and a plurality of teeth struck from opposite ends of the legs for being driven into the chord members. The teeth struck from of each leg are oriented to present their relatively wide surfaces generally broadside within the range of 45.degree.-90.degree. with respect to the central longitudinal plane of the leg for maximizing the resistance of the teeth to movement through the wood chord members so as to increase the load-holding capacity of the web member.
